First and foremost, consider your dietary choices. Nutrition plays a vital role in brain health. Foods rich in omega-3 fatty acids, antioxidants, and vitamins can significantly impact cognitive performance. Incorporate fatty fish, nuts, leafy greens, and berries into your meals. These foods help improve memory and concentration by providing essential nutrients that support brain function. Hydration is equally important; ensure that you drink plenty of water throughout the day, as even mild dehydration can impair cognitive abilities.
Another essential aspect of enhancing mental clarity is regular physical exercise. Engaging in physical activity increases blood flow to the brain and encourages the growth of new brain cells, which can improve memory and cognitive skills. Aim for at least 30 minutes of moderate exercise most days of the week. This could include activities like walking, jogging, cycling, or even participating in a dance class. Not only does exercise boost your physical health, but it also releases endorphins, which can elevate your mood and reduce stress levels.
Sleep is another crucial factor in cognitive performance. Adults typically need between 7 to 9 hours of quality sleep each night. Lack of sleep can lead to impaired judgment, difficulty concentrating, and reduced problem-solving abilities. To improve your sleep quality, establish a calming bedtime routine, create a comfortable sleeping environment, and limit exposure to screens before bedtime. Adequate rest will leave you feeling more refreshed and ready to tackle daily challenges.
Mindfulness and meditation practices can also significantly boost cognitive function. By dedicating just a few minutes each day to mindfulness activities, you can train your brain to focus better and reduce stress. Meditation has been shown to increase grey matter density in the brain, which is associated with improved memory and emotional regulation. Try incorporating deep-breathing exercises, guided visualization, or mindful walking into your daily routine to foster a greater sense of calm and clarity.
Consider the role of cognitive training programs as well. Mental exercises, such as puzzles, reading, or learning a new skill, stimulate the brain and can enhance memory and cognitive flexibility. Apps and online platforms offer various brain games specifically designed to challenge and engage your mind. Find something that interests you, and make it a habit to practice regularly.

Lastly, limit distractions in your work and home environment. Create a dedicated workspace free from interruptions, and establish boundaries with those around you. Use tools like timers or productivity apps to help maintain focus during tasks. Additionally, practice the art of saying “no” to activities or commitments that detract from your priorities. Streamlining your responsibilities will allow you to dedicate more mental resources to tasks that truly matter.
